Criminal defense law in Dumka, a city in Jharkhand, India, pertains to the legal protections afforded to individuals accused of committing crimes. The Indian Penal Code (IPC), Code of Criminal Procedure (CrPC), and the Indian Evidence Act form the backbone of criminal law in India. The judiciary in Dumka, as elsewhere in India, ensures that the legal rights of the accused are upheld and that justice is served. This includes everything from defending clients against minor infractions to serious felonies.

Immediately invoke your right to stay silent and ask for a lawyer. Don't sign any documents without legal counsel.
Bail is generally possible for many offenses but depends on the gravity of the charge and specific circumstances. A lawyer can assist in filing a bail application.
You have the right to remain silent, the right to legal counsel, and the right to be informed of the charges against you.
A criminal defense lawyer represents you in court, helps in preparing your defense, advises you on legal matters, and ensures your rights are protected.
The duration varies depending on the complexity of the case, the court's schedule, and other factors. Simple cases may be resolved quickly, while complex cases can take months or even years.
An FIR is a written document prepared by the police when they receive information about the commission of a cognizable offense. It marks the beginning of the investigation.
Indian law allows for expungement under certain circumstances, such as wrongful arrest or acquittal. Consult a lawyer for specific advice.
Anticipatory bail is a pre-arrest legal process wherein the court provides bail to the accused before arrest to prevent potential detention.
Contact a criminal defense lawyer immediately to help you gather evidence and defend your case effectively.
A criminal trial involves several stages including the presentation of evidence by prosecution and defense, examination of witnesses, and the final judgment. Legal representation is crucial throughout this process.
